2. Breathe Into the Unknown
Panic arises when we contract against uncertainty. The body tenses, the breath shortens, and the mind races to “figure it out.” But true power comes from expanding into the tension rather than resisting it.
Try this practice when you feel overwhelmed:
• Pause and notice where you feel the tension in your body.
• Breathe deeply, expanding your belly and chest. Instead of trying to change the feeling, simply witness it.
• Exhale slowly, imagining yourself softening into the unknown.
By consciously breathing through the discomfort, you send a signal to your nervous system that you are safe—even in uncertainty.

4. Anchor Into Your Body
When panic sets in, it’s usually because we’ve left the body and become trapped in the mind. To stay grounded, bring yourself back into your physical form:
• Move your body—shake, stretch, dance, or walk barefoot on the earth.
• Place your hands on your heart and womb, feeling the warmth of your own touch.
• Use grounding statements like: I am safe. I am held. I can trust the unknown.
The body is the key to anchoring your feminine power. When you stay in your body, you remain present rather than spiraling into anxiety.
